Western theatre production processes are historically characterized by their logos-centered approach. Therefore, the text is the starting point of all creative work. In this context, the theatrical text, as a literary phenomenon, is at the forefront of the action, whereby the “performance” of the text within a performance itself is often only perceived as a “disturbing” accessory. If, however, one entertains phenomenological thoughts in relation to the aesthetic production processes in theatre, one does not refer explicitly and exclusively to a text as a mental, cognitive construction of sense and meaning; rather, one extends the aesthetic working process to all the parameters involved in the interrelated theatre production process. The resulting theatrical expression is more than just logos in the form of a text. It is logos in an extended sense, which in turn can be perceived and experienced bodily, as well as sensually by the recipient. As a consequence, the theatre artist is offered new approaches to the performative understanding of a theatrical text. In this context, such a purposeful observation and perception of a particular appearance is of decisive importance. On the basis of these phenomenological considerations for the presentation of a theatre text on stage, we examine the libretto of W. A. Mozart’s “The Abduction from the Seraglio” in order to show how a translation of the spoken dialogues (prose) of this Singspiel into Greek allows the Greek-speaking audience a performative approach to the text.

This article shows how dividing into different phases in devised theatre production can be used as a tool to structure and accommodate a creative group-devised process. The article starts by giving a brief outline of devised theatre, its genealogy and roots with regard to developing new ways of organising creative work. A theoretical framework is developed by using Lev Vygotsky’s Theory of Creativity, and his outline of the nature of the creative circle is adapted into four different phases for the devising processes. These phases are: 1) The starting point, where ideas are generated through group improvisations; 2) the phase when the material is explored and developed into more concrete material. In the third phase 3), the material is structured and formed, and in the last phase 4), the creative material is given its final form and performed in front of an audience. In addition to this, the article focuses on how devised work can be organised by dividing the various tasks and roles in the production in alternative ways.

This article analyses the aesthetics of silent political resistance by focusing on refugees’ silent political action. The starting point for the analysis is Jacques Rancière’s philosophy and his theorisation of the aesthetics of politics. The article enquires into the aesthetic meaning of silent refugee activism and interprets how refugees’ silent acts of resistance can constitute aesthetically effective resistance to what can be called the ‘speech system’ of statist, representative democracy. The article analyses silence as a political tactic and interprets the emancipatory meaning of silent politics for refugees. It argues that refugees’ silent acts of political resistance can powerfully affect aesthetic, political subversion in prevailing legal-political contexts.

Industry 4.0, a term invented by Wolfgang Wahlster in Germany, is celebrating its 10th anniversary in 2021. Still, the digitalization of the production environment is one of the hottest topics in the computer science departments at universities and companies. Optimization of production processes or redefinition of the production concepts is meaningful in light of the current industrial and research agendas. Both the mentioned optimization and redefinition are considered in numerous subtopics and technologies. One of the most significant topics in these areas is the newest findings and applications of artificial intelligence (AI)—machine learning (ML) and deep convolutional neural networks (DCNNs). The authors invented a method and device that supports the wiring assembly in the control cabinet production process, namely, the Wire Label Reader (WLR) industrial system. The implementation of this device was a big technical challenge. It required very advanced IT technologies, ML, image recognition, and DCNN as well. This paper focuses on an in-depth description of the underlying methodology of this device, its construction, and foremostly, the assembly industrial processes, through which this device is implemented. It was significant for the authors to validate the usability of the device within mentioned production processes and to express both advantages and challenges connected to such assembly process development. The authors noted that in-depth studies connected to the effects of AI applications in the presented area are sparse. Further, the idea of the WLR device is presented while also including results of DCNN training (with recognition results of 99.7% although challenging conditions), the device implementation in the wire assembly production process, and its users’ opinions. The authors have analyzed how the WLR affects assembly process time and energy consumption, and accordingly, the advantages and challenges of the device. Among the most impressive results of the WLR implementation in the assembly process one can be mentioned—the device ensures significant process time reduction regardless of the number of characters printed on a wire.

ABSTRACTMethanol is already an important carbon feedstock in the chemical industry, but it has found only limited application in biotechnological production processes. This can be mostly attributed to the inability of most microbial platform organisms to utilize methanol as a carbon and energy source. With the aim to turn methanol into a suitable feedstock for microbial production processes, we engineered the industrially important but nonmethylotrophic bacteriumCorynebacterium glutamicumtoward the utilization of methanol as an auxiliary carbon source in a sugar-based medium. Initial oxidation of methanol to formaldehyde was achieved by heterologous expression of a methanol dehydrogenase fromBacillus methanolicus, whereas assimilation of formaldehyde was realized by implementing the two key enzymes of the ribulose monophosphate pathway ofBacillus subtilis: 3-hexulose-6-phosphate synthase and 6-phospho-3-hexuloisomerase. The recombinantC. glutamicumstrain showed an average methanol consumption rate of 1.7 ± 0.3 mM/h (mean ± standard deviation) in a glucose-methanol medium, and the culture grew to a higher cell density than in medium without methanol. In addition, [13C]methanol-labeling experiments revealed labeling fractions of 3 to 10% in the m + 1 mass isotopomers of various intracellular metabolites. In the background of aC. glutamicumΔaldΔadhEmutant being strongly impaired in its ability to oxidize formaldehyde to CO2, the m + 1 labeling of these intermediates was increased (8 to 25%), pointing toward higher formaldehyde assimilation capabilities of this strain. The engineeredC. glutamicumstrains represent a promising starting point for the development of sugar-based biotechnological production processes using methanol as an auxiliary substrate.

Thinking creatively, is a necessary condition of the Design process to transform ideas into novel solutions and break barriers to creativity. Although, there are many techniques and ways to stimulate creative thinking for designers, however, this research paper adopts SCAMPER; which is acronym of: Substitute- Combine-Adapt- Modify or Magnify-Put to another use-Eliminate-Reverse or Rearrange- to integrate the sustainability concepts within architectural design process. Many creative artifacts have been designed consciously or unconsciously adopting SCAMPER strategies such as rehabilitation and reuse projects to improve the functional performance or the aesthetic sense of an existing building for the better. SCAMPER is recognized as a divergent thinking tool are used during the initial ideation stage, aims to leave the usual way of thinking to generate a wide range of new ideas that will lead to new insights, original ideas, and creative solutions to problems. The research focuses on applying this method in the architectural design, which is rarely researched, through reviewing seven examples that have been designed consciously or unconsciously adopting SCAMPER mnemonic techniques. The paper aims to establish a starting point for further research to deepen it and study its potentials in solving architectural design problems.

The article presents the outcomes of a group model-building project at a chemical company that produces calcium carbide. The project led not only to the creation of a system dynamics model describing the production process but also to a microworld, a computer-based interactive learning environment meant to reproduce most of the features of the operating and controlling software actually used in the company. The process of organizational learning, the gaining of a better common understanding of the production process, and the development of the different mental models of the plant operators were some of the project's main goals. Moreover, the method followed during the project can be considered as general and can be used mainly in a variety of production processes in most manufacturing industrial firms both for the modeling of production processes and for teaching and training the operators who manage such systems.

The paper represents a kind of contribution to the methodology considering the phenomenon of music literacy. It suggests some guidelines to be observed for future research. Acquired findings of the main reasons for the emergence of the Neum notation as well as of the shaping process of the chanting book during the first stage of the written musical tradition (from the end of the 10th to the middle of the 11th centuries) served as a starting point, but it was pointed out who might have been a scribal team member, what professional qualification he was expected to have and what was an organization of rewriting process like, depending on type of manuscripts that served as copying models. An interpretation of chanting book function was also presented and its main purpose in liturgical life practice after the establishing of the middle Byzantine Neum notation.

Thirty-nine Champagnes from six different brands originating from the AOC Champagne area were analyzed for major and trace element concentrations in the context of their production processes and in relation to their geographical origins. Inorganic analyses were performed on the must (i.e., grape juice) originating from different AOC areas and the final Champagne. The observed elemental concentrations displayed a very narrow range of variability. Typical concentrations observed in Champagne are expressed in mg/L for elements such as K, Ca, Mg, Na, B, Fe, A, and Mn. They are expressed in µg/L for trace elements such as Sr, Rb, Ba, Cu, Ni, Pb Cr and Li in decreasing order of concentrations. This overall homogeneity was observed for Sr and Rb in particular, which showed a very narrow range of concentrations (150 < Rb < 300 µg/L and 150 < Sr < 350 µg/L) in Champagne. The musts contained similar levels of concentration but showed slightly higher variability since they are directly influenced by the bedrock, which is quite homogenous in the AOC area being studied. Besides the homogeneity of the bedrock, the overall stability of the concentrations recorded in the samples can also be directly linked to the successive blending steps, both at the must level and prior to the final bottling. A detailed analysis of the main additives, sugar, yeast and bentonite, during the Champagne production process, did not show a major impact on the elemental signature of Champagne.

The essay takes as a starting point Goebbels’ speech delivered at the closing session of the Continental Advertising Congress, held in Vienna in June 1938, and explores the transformations that the communicational public space of the first half of the twentieth century underwent following the two world conflicts that erupted then. In the first part, the essay addresses the progressive hybridisation of public discourse at the time, the increasing blurring of information, advertising and propaganda, and the rapid acceleration of the international circulation of communication during the period. In this context, special attention is paid to actors who, though not new to the international political scene – such as foreign correspondents and news agencies –, gained a new and decisive importance throughout the period in question. The second part analyses two case studies involving these actors and their power on the international political scene during World War II. Geographically, the two case studies are centred around an axis that is usually considered peripheral to the war – neutral Portugal – but which appears central and, in a way, paradigmatic to the “Great War of Words” that was also being fought in the international public space.
